King Uzziah (783-742 BC) reigned in the ancient kingdom of Judah, which had splintered from the kingdom of Israel. Uzziah, the ninth king of Judea, had been only sixteen years old when he was proclaimed ruler. Currently, the stratigraphic evidence at Gezer dates the earthquake at 760 BC, plus or minus 25 years,[11] while Yadin and Finkelstein date the earthquake level at Hazor to 760 BC based on stratigraphic analysis of the destruction debris. The reference to Jeroboam II is helpful in restricting the date of Amos' vision, more so than the reference to Uzziah's long reign of 52 years. Who was cursed with leprosy in the Bible? William F. Albright has dated his reign to 783 B.C.E.-742 B.C.E., while E. R. Thiele offers the dates 767 B.C.E.-740 B.C.E.
